The Miami Dolphins have spent a decade in mediocrity, a decade dealing with stories about the "dysfunction" in the franchise and things like bully scandals, interviewing coaches while still employing a coach, and coaches not going to Alabama. The Dolphins have struggled basically since Dan Marino retired after the 1999 season, including five hired and fired head coaches, three interim head coaches, nine different leading passers, six winning seasons and just three playoff appearances.
